In recent years, vaping has gained immense popularity, particularly among the youth in the Philippines. Many people turn to vape as a perceived safer alternative to traditional cigarettes. However, some users experience discomfort, notably an itchy sensation every time they use their vape. This article explores the reasons behind this irritation and offers insights on how to mitigate the issue.
Firstly, the itchy sensation associated with vaping can often be attributed to the ingredients in vape liquids, specifically the propylene glycol (PG) and vegetable glycerin (VG) base. While these ingredients are generally recognized as safe, they can cause allergic reactions or sensitivities in some individuals. In the Philippines, where the climate is hot and humid, the use of PG-based e-liquids may exacerbate dry throat and skin conditions, leading to an itchy feeling.
Moreover, flavoring agents in vape liquids can also contribute to irritation. Many e-liquids contain artificial flavors, which can provoke allergic reactions or sensitivities in certain users. This is particularly concerning in the Philippines, where consumers might gravitate towards vibrant fruit or dessert flavors that are often laden with various additives. When inhaled, these flavorings can irritate the delicate lining of the throat and lungs, resulting in an uncomfortable itch.
Another plausible reason for the itchy sensation is the technique of vaping. New users might not be accustomed to inhaling vapor, and improper techniques, such as taking excessively deep puffs, can irritate the throat. This is common among those who are transitioning from smoking to vaping. In the humid environment of the Philippines, the combination of heat and inhaled vapor might create a paradox where the throat feels irritated instead of soothed.
To address the issue of itchiness, users should consider using vape liquids with higher VG content, as VG is thicker and less irritating than PG. Additionally, switching to nicotine salts can provide a smoother throat hit and reduce the likelihood of irritation. It’s also advisable for users to take slow, shallow puffs rather than deep inhales to give their throat time to adjust. Finally, hydration plays a crucial role; drinking plenty of water can help alleviate dry throat symptoms that contribute to itchiness.
